Understanding Web Scraping: Web scraping, also known as web harvesting or web data extraction, is the process of automatically collecting information from websites. Traditionally, this involved writing custom scripts or using scraping tools to navigate web pages and extract desired data elements. However, manual coding is time-consuming, error-prone, and limited in scalability, especially when dealing with large or dynamic websites. The concept of artificial intelligence (AI) in web scraping entails employing advanced algorithms and techniques to automate and optimize the extraction of data from websites. AI-driven scraping tools leverage machine learning, natural language processing, and computer vision to intelligently navigate through web pages, identify relevant content, and extract structured data accurately and efficiently. By analyzing webpage structures, understanding textual and visual content, and adapting to changes in website layouts, AI-powered scrapers can overcome challenges such as anti-scraping measures and dynamic web environments. This enables businesses to gather valuable insights from vast amounts of online data, enhance decision-making processes, and stay competitive in today’s data-driven landscape. The Role of Artificial Intelligence: Artificial intelligence, particularly machine learning (ML) and natural language processing (NLP), has transformed the landscape of web scraping. By leveraging AI techniques, scraping tools can mimic human browsing behavior, understand webpage structures, and extract relevant information intelligently. Here’s how AI is revolutionizing web scraping: Automated Data Extraction: AI-powered scraping tools can automatically identify and extract data from web pages without explicit programming. These tools use machine learning algorithms to recognize patterns in webpage layouts and content, enabling them to extract structured data accurately and efficiently. Adaptive Scraping: Traditional scraping methods often fail when websites undergo layout changes or introduce new elements. AI-based scraping tools, however, can adapt to these changes by learning from past scraping experiences. Through continuous training and feedback loops, these tools can adjust their scraping strategies to maintain high accuracy and reliability over time. Content Understanding: One of the key challenges in web scraping is understanding unstructured or semi-structured content, such as text within articles or product descriptions. AI techniques, particularly natural language processing (NLP), enable scraping tools to parse and extract meaningful information from textual data. This includes identifying entities, extracting sentiment, and categorizing content, enhancing the quality and depth of scraped data. Anti-Crawling Bypass: Many websites deploy anti-scraping measures to prevent automated data extraction, such as CAPTCHA challenges or IP blocking. AI-powered scraping tools can circumvent these obstacles by dynamically adapting their scraping behavior to mimic human interactions. By simulating mouse movements, keyboard inputs, and session management, these tools can evade detection and access target websites more effectively. Visual Data Extraction: In addition to text-based content, AI enables scraping tools to extract information from images, videos, and other multimedia elements. Computer vision algorithms can analyze visual data, recognize objects or text within images, and extract relevant information for further processing. This capability is particularly valuable for e-commerce platforms, where product information often includes images and videos. AI and Machine Learning for Web Scraping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) have revolutionized the fields of web scraping and data mining, bringing about profound changes in how we collect, analyze, and derive insights from data on the internet. By leveraging AI and ML, web scraping and data mining becomes more accurate, adaptive and became capable of handling complex data sources. Scraping Solution has developed a list of key benefits one can get by utilizing the concept of AI and ML in their daily data scraping projects. 1. Improved Data Extraction Accuracy: AI and machine learning algorithms can be trained to recognize patterns and structures within web pages, making them more accurate at extracting specific data elements. Traditional web scraping methods might break if a website’s structure changes, but AI-powered scrapers can adapt to such changes. 2. Natural Language Processing (NLP): NLP models can be applied to web scraping to extract information from unstructured text data. This is especially useful when scraping articles, reviews, or other text-heavy web content. NLP can help identify key entities, sentiments, and more. 3. Image and Video Analysis: Machine learning models can be used to analyze images and videos scraped from websites. This is valuable for applications like product recognition, content moderation, and visual data analysis. 4. Dynamic Page Handling: Many modern websites use JavaScript to load content dynamically. AI and machine learning can be employed to interact with these dynamic elements and extract data as it becomes available. This is crucial for scraping content from single-page applications (SPAs). 5. Anti-Bot Detection Evasion: Websites often employ anti-scraping mechanisms to block or hinder automated scrapers. AI can be used to develop strategies to evade these anti-bot measures, such as rotating IP addresses, mimicking human behavior, and solving CAPTCHAs. 6. Content Summarization: AI can automatically summarize lengthy web content, making it easier to extract meaningful information from large volumes of text. 7. Data Enrichment: Machine learning models can be used to enrich scraped data by identifying and linking related information. For example, scraping product data and then using AI to associate it with customer reviews. 8. Optimizing Scraping Strategies: AI can analyze websites to determine the best scraping strategy, such as identifying the most efficient order to visit pages or deciding when to refresh data. 9. Language Translation: Machine translation models can be used to translate web content from one language to another while scraping, broadening the scope of accessible data. 10. Auto-categorization: AI can automatically categorize and tag scraped content based on its content, making it easier to organize and analyze large datasets. Let’s dive into the world of AI and discover the tools that are shaping the future today:  TensorFlow: Description: An open-source machine learning framework developed by Google. It offers a flexible and comprehensive ecosystem for building and training machine learning models, especially neural networks.  Use: Deep learning, neural network development, natural language processing, computer vision, reinforcement learning. PyTorch: Description: An open-source deep learning framework developed by Facebook’s AI Research lab. It features dynamic computation graphs and is popular for its ease of use, making it a favorite among researchers.  Use: Deep learning research, neural network development, dynamic computation, natural language processing, computer vision. Scikit-learn: Description: A widely used open-source machine learning library for traditional machine learning algorithms. It provides simple and efficient tools for data analysis and modeling. Use: Classification, regression, clustering, dimensionality reduction, model selection, preprocessing. NLTK (Natural Language Toolkit): Description: A Python library for natural language processing and text analysis. It offers tools for tokenization, stemming, tagging, parsing, and other linguistic tasks. Use: Text analysis, natural language processing, sentiment analysis, language generation, linguistic research. SpaCy:  Description: An open-source natural language processing library known for its speed and accuracy. It provides pre-trained models and tools for various NLP tasks. Use: Part-of-speech tagging, named entity recognition, dependency parsing, text classification, text summarization. OpenCV: Description: An open-source computer vision library with a broad range of algorithms for image and video processing. It’s used for object detection, facial recognition, and more.  Use: Image manipulation, feature extraction, object tracking, facial recognition, augmented reality. IBM Watson: Description: IBM’s AI platform that offers various AI services, including natural language understanding, chatbots, and image recognition, accessible through APIs. Use: Chatbot development, language translation, image analysis, sentiment analysis, text-to-speech. Amazon SageMaker: Description: A managed machine learning service by Amazon Web Services (AWS) that covers the entire machine learning lifecycle, from data preprocessing to model deployment. Use: Model training, hyperparameter tuning, model deployment, automated machine learning. Microsoft Cognitive Services: Description: A collection of AI APIs and services by Microsoft, enabling developers to integrate AI capabilities like computer vision, speech recognition, and language understanding into their applications. Use: Image recognition, speech-to-text, text-to-speech, sentiment analysis, language translation. Dialogflow: Description: A Google Cloud service for building conversational interfaces, such as chatbots and voice assistants, using natural language understanding and conversation management. Use: Chatbot development, voice interactions, natural language understanding, intent recognition. Wit.ai: Description: An open-source natural language processing platform by Facebook that focuses on speech recognition and language understanding, enabling developers to build applications with conversational interfaces. Use: Speech recognition, intent recognition, chatbot development, voice-controlled applications. Rasa: Description: An open-source conversational AI platform that includes tools for building and deploying chatbots and virtual assistants. It emphasizes natural language understanding and interactive dialog management. Use: Chatbot development, intent recognition, dialogue management, voice interactions. H2O.ai: Description: An open-source platform for building machine learning models, including AutoML capabilities that automate the process of model selection and hyperparameter tuning. Use: Model building, automated machine learning, data analysis, classification, regression. AutoML (Automated Machine Learning): Description: While not a single tool, AutoML refers to the use of automated techniques to simplify and accelerate the process of building machine learning models. Tools like Google AutoML and Auto-Keras fall under this category. Use: Automated model selection, hyperparameter tuning, feature engineering, model deployment. Clarifai: Description: A platform that specializes in visual recognition using deep learning models. It offers APIs for image and video analysis to identify objects, concepts, and scenes. Use: Image and video recognition, object detection, concept tagging, visual content analysis. Caffe: Description: A deep learning framework developed by the Berkeley Vision and Learning Center (BVLC) known for its efficiency in image classification tasks, especially with convolutional neural networks. Use: Image classification, convolutional neural networks, deep learning for images. BigML: Description: A cloud-based machine learning platform that provides tools for creating, deploying, and sharing machine learning models, as well as features for automated machine learning. Use: Model creation, ensemble learning, clustering, regression, classification. Orange: Description: An open-source data visualization and analysis tool with machine learning components. It offers a visual programming interface suitable for users with varying levels of technical expertise.  Use: Data visualization, data analysis, machine learning experimentation, educational tool. Jupyter Notebook: Description: An open-source web application that allows users to create and share documents containing live code, equations, visualizations, and narrative text, making it popular for interactive data analysis and prototyping. Use: Data exploration, data analysis, prototyping, code documentation, interactive visualization. Tableau: Description: A data visualization tool that simplifies the creation of interactive and shareable dashboards from various data sources, helping users uncover insights and trends. Use: Data visualization, business intelligence, interactive dashboards, exploratory data analysis. Remember that this is not an exhaustive list and the field of AI tools is constantly evolving.                         Web Scraping for AI   Web scraping and Data mining indeed plays a significant role in training machine learning models and improving AI algorithms by providing access to vast amounts of data for analysis. Here’s how web scraping contributes to these aspects: Data Collection Machine learning models and AI algorithms thrive on data. The more diverse and relevant data they are trained on, the better their performance. Web scraping enables the extraction of data from various websites, including text, images, tables, and more. This data can encompass a wide range of domains, such as e-commerce, news, social media, finance, and more. This diverse data collection is essential for training models that can generalize well to real-world scenarios. Data Enrichment Web scraping allows for the aggregation of data from different sources, enriching the dataset with complementary information. This can lead to better feature representation and improved model performance. For example, gathering product reviews, ratings, and prices from multiple e-commerce websites can provide a more comprehensive understanding of consumer sentiment and market trends. Training Supervised Models Supervised machine learning models, which learn from labeled data, benefit from large and accurately labeled datasets. Web scraping can help collect labeled training data by extracting information such as image captions, text sentiment labels, entity recognition tags, and more. This is crucial for training models like image classifiers, sentiment analyzers, and named entity recognition systems. Text and NLP Tasks Web scraping is commonly used for Natural Language Processing (NLP) tasks. Websites contain a wealth of textual data in the form of articles, blog posts, reviews, comments, and more. This text can be used to train NLP models for tasks like text classification, sentiment analysis, language translation, and summarization. Image and Vision Tasks Web scraping can also be employed to gather images for training computer vision models. Collecting images from various sources can help train models for tasks like object detection, image classification, facial recognition, and image generation. Data Augmentation Web scraping contributes to data augmentation, a technique where additional training samples are generated by slightly modifying the existing data. This can improve model generalization and robustness. For instance, by scraping images from different angles or lighting conditions, a model trained on augmented data can perform better in real-world scenarios. Keeping Models Up-to-date Web scraping allows models to be updated with the latest data, ensuring they remain relevant and accurate over time. For instance, news sentiment analysis models can benefit from continuous updates by scraping the latest news articles. Research and Innovation Web scraping enables researchers and data scientists to explore new datasets, domains, and perspectives. This can lead to the development of innovative AI algorithms and models that address emerging challenges. However, it’s important to note that web scraping must be done responsibly and ethically. Some websites may have terms of use that prohibit scraping, and respecting these terms is crucial to maintaining ethical practices. Additionally, scraping too aggressively can put a strain on servers and potentially lead to legal issues. In conclusion, web scraping provides a valuable source of diverse and extensive data that’s essential for training robust and accurate machine learning models and improving AI algorithms across various domains and applications. How To Integrate Web Scraping with API Consumption? Integrating web scraping with API consumption involves combining two different techniques to extract data from websites and interact with APIs.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to integrate web scraping with API consumption: Understand the difference between web scraping and API consumption: Web scraping: It involves extracting data from websites by parsing the HTML structure and retrieving specific information. You can read more about the website scraping here API consumption: It involves interacting with an API (Application Programming Interface) to send requests and receive structured data in a specific format, such as JSON or XML. Identify the target website and the API: Determine the website from which you want to scrape data. Identify the API that provides the data you want to consume. Choose a programming language: Select a programming language that supports web scraping and API consumption. Python is a popular choice due to its rich ecosystem and libraries. Web scraping: Use a web scraping library like Beautiful Soup or Scrapy to extract data from the website. Inspect the website’s HTML structure and identify the elements that contain the desired data. Write code to navigate the HTML structure, find the relevant elements, and extract the data. API consumption: Use a library like `requests` in Python to interact with the API. Read the API documentation to understand the endpoints, request methods, and required parameters. Write code to send requests to the API, including any necessary headers, parameters, or authentication tokens. Receive the API’s response and parse the data in the desired format (JSON, XML, etc.). Combine web scraping and API consumption: Once you have the data from web scraping and the API, you can combine them as needed.For example, you can use the scraped data to retrieve specific identifiers or parameters required for the API requests. Alternatively, you can enrich the scraped data with additional information obtained from the API. Handle rate limits and ethical considerations: When integrating web scraping and API consumption, be mindful of the website’s terms of service and API usage policies. Respect rate limits imposed by both the website and the API to avoid overloading their servers. Implement delay mechanisms or use proxy servers if necessary to prevent IP blocking or other restrictions. Data processing and storage: Process and clean the data obtained from web scraping and API consumption. Store the data in a suitable format, such as a database, CSV file, or JSON document. Remember that when scraping websites and consuming APIs, it’s important to be aware of legal and ethical considerations. Always ensure that you have the necessary permissions to scrape a website, respect the website’s terms of service, and comply with any applicable laws or regulations. Chat GPT-Evolution Chat GPT is an application of machine learning, specifically based on the GPT-3.5 architecture developed by Open AI. Machine learning is a subfield of artificial intelligence (AI) that focuses on creating algorithms and models that can learn and make predictions or decisions based on data.   In the case of Chat GPT, it has been trained on a vast amount of text data to understand and generate human-like responses to user inputs. The training process involves exposing the model to large datasets and using techniques such as deep learning to learn patterns and relationships within the data. Machine learning algorithms like the one used in Chat GPT are typically designed to generalize from the training data to make predictions or generate outputs on new, unseen data. In the case of Chat GPT, it has learned to understand natural language inputs and produce coherent and contextually relevant responses. The training process for Chat GPT involves presenting the model with input-output pairs, where the input is a prompt or a portion of text, and the output is the expected response. The model learns to map the input to the output by adjusting its internal parameters through an optimization process called backpropagation and gradient descent. This iterative process helps the model improve its performance over time. It’s important to note that Chat GPT is a specific instance of a machine learning model trained for conversational tasks. Machine learning encompasses a wide range of algorithms and techniques beyond just language models and it is a rapidly evolving field with ongoing research and advancements. Let’s us talk about the evolution of Chat GPT starting from GPT-1 to GPT-4. GPT-1: It was released in 2018 and It had 117 million parameters. Its core strength was to generate fluent, logical and consistent language when given a prompt or context. This model was a combination of two datasets: Common Crawl (a set of web pages with billions of words) and the Book Corpus (a collection of over 11,000 books on various genres). These datasets allow GPT-1 to develop strong language modeling abilities. But GPT-1 also had some limitations, like it provides solutions to only short text only and longer passages would lack logic. It also failed to reason over multiple turns of dialogue and could not track long-term dependencies in text. GPT-2: After GPT-1, Open AI was set to release GPT-2 as a better chatbot named as GPT-2. It was released in 2019 as a successor to GPT-1. It contained 1.5 billion parameters which are larger than GPT-1. This model was trained on a great dataset than GPT-1 combining Common Crawl, Book Corpus, and Web Text. One of its abilities is to generate logical and real-time texts sequence. It also generates human-like responses which makes it more valuable than different NLP technologies. It also had some limitations like it found difficulties with complex reasoning and understanding. While it excelled in short paragraphs, it also failed to maintain logical reasoning in long paragraphs. GPT-3: NLP models made exponential leaps with the release of GPT-3 in 2020. It contains 175 billion parameters. GPT-3 is about 100 times larger than GPT-1 and 10 times larger than GPT-2. It is trained on a large range of data sources including Common Crawl, Book Corpus, Wikipedia, Books, Articles, and more. It contains trillions of words that generate sophisticated responses on NLP tasks, even without providing any prior example data. GPT-3 is the improved version of GPT-1 and GPT-2. The main improvement of GPT-3 is that, it has a great ability to provide logical reasoning, write codes, and logical texts and even create art. It understands the context and gives answers according to that. It also creates a natural-sounding text which has huge implications for applications like language translation. Where GPT-3 has a lot of advantages, it also has flaws in it. For example, it can provide inappropriate responses sometimes. It is because of this, GPT-3 is based on a massive amount of text that contains biased and inappropriate information. Misuse of such a powerful language model also arose in this era to create malware, fake news, and phishing emails. GPT-4: It is the latest model of the GPT series, which is launched on March 14, 2023. It is a better version of GPT-3 which already impresses everyone.
